An oil spill can have detrimental effects on algae by coating them in a layer of oil, which disrupts their ability to photosynthesize and absorb nutrients from the water. This can lead to decreased growth and reproduction rates, ultimately impacting the entire aquatic ecosystem. Additionally, the toxic components of the oil may harm or kill algal populations, reducing biodiversity and altering food webs in the affected area. Overall, an oil spill poses a significant threat to algal health and the ecosystems they support.
